Julian Gramma (born April 22, 1994), professionally known as J Gramm (also known as J Gramm Beats), is a Grammy nominated[2][3] Canadian record producer from Ottawa, Ontario, now based in Los Angeles, California.[4] J Gramm is best known for producing records for artists such as Travis Scott, Young Thug, 2 Chainz, Kid Ink, DeJ Loaf, Wiz Khalifa, Kehlani, Fetty Wap, Lil Yachty and other acts.[5][6][7]

Early life

Julian Gramma was born on April 22, 1994 in Montreal, Quebec. His family relocated to Ottawa, Ontario shortly after he was born.

Career

Production

J Gramm began producing songs as a teenager. While in high school, he utilized the internet by selling beats online and submitting his instrumentals to artists through e-mail. The week J graduated high school, he moved to LA and got his first big break producing four songs on Travis Scott's debut project Owl Pharaoh. One of the songs, (Upper Echelon) featuring 2 Chainz & T.I. went on to be Travis' first hit single. To date, J Gramm has produced for popular artists such as Travis Scott, Pusha T, Wale, 2 Chainz, Kehlani, Wiz Khalifa, Young Thug, Vince Staples,[8][9] amongst many others. JGramm has recently been in the Studio with Britney Spears.[10]
